What Does a Workers' Compensation Insurance Agent in Stafford Springs Cost?

Workers compensation insurance costs in Connecticut typically range from 0.75 to 2.50 per 100 dollars of payroll for low risk office jobs and up to 15 to 25 dollars per 100 dollars of payroll for high risk construction work. Actual premiums depend on your specific industry payroll and loss history. This is general information and not insurance advice.

What are the workers compensation requirements for businesses in Stafford Springs Connecticut?
Connecticut law requires all employers with one or more employees to carry workers compensation insurance. This includes part time and seasonal workers. Failure to comply can result in fines and stop work orders from the state.
How can a workers compensation insurance agent help my Stafford Springs business?
An agent can review your business operations and recommend appropriate coverage levels. They can also explain Connecticut specific rules such as the classification system and payroll reporting. This helps ensure you are compliant and not overpaying.
